What is the scientific name of Spotted Knapweed?
The scientific name of Spotted Knapweed is Centaurea stoebe. It belongs to the genus Centaurea.

What family does Spotted Knapweed belong to?
Spotted Knapweed (Centaurea stoebe) belongs to the genus Centaurea, which is part of the taxonomic family Asteraceae.
What kingdom does Spotted Knapweed belong to?
Spotted Knapweed (Centaurea stoebe) belongs to the kingdom Plantae (Plants).
